Quicker
主页
下载
专业版
分享
动作库
子程序
扩展热键
文本指令
动作单
应用程序
文档
文档中心首页
软件使用手册
组合动作开发
知识库
版本更新
版本更新(归档)
异常反馈
讨论
外观
登录
注册
动作库
子程序
正则表达式
自定义表达式正则替换
自定义表达式正则替换
公开
CL
更新于
2022-01-28 08:39
|
2
|
(0)
|
164
复制链接
如何使用分享的子程序?
信息
版本
1
讨论
0
点评
0
相关
分类
正则表达式
点赞
Joker_D
瞑空凌
等
2
人点赞了这个动作。
更多信息
分享人
CL
分享时间
2022-01-28 08:39
最后更新
2022-01-28 08:39
修订版本
0
子程序大小
2.2 KB
Quicker版本
1.29.0.0
介绍
根据自定义的表达式对匹配内容变换后替换
适用于较为复杂的替换逻辑。
变换表达式:
使用x表示每个匹配项的文本(c# string类型)。如有需要也可以通过match访问到当前的匹配项(C#Match对象)
使用return返回生成后的文本结果。必须为c#的string类型。
示例:
目的:将文件名 “DED 160 世界上第一个超时.md” 中的数字加1。
正则表达式:\d+
变换表达式:return (Convert.ToInt32(x)+1).ToString();
子程序的参数
输入
输入
原始内容
Text
正则表达式
匹配要替换的内容
Text
变换表达式
表达式。在其中使用x表示匹配的文本,使用return语句返回结果。
Text
输出
结果文本
替换后的结果
Text
最近更新
修订版本
更新时间
更新说明
0
2022-01-28 08:39
更多...
最近讨论
暂无讨论
更多...
已复制到剪贴板,请在Quicker面板的空白按钮上点右键粘贴。
已复制到剪贴板。